Value At Risk – Investment Companies:
Two days course
This program will first establish the building blocks of risk
management, risk, return, normal distributions, correlation
and volatility. Next, attention will turn to the measurement
of VaR and how it is used in a practical environment. Focus
will be on historical and Monte Carlo simulations. The program
will feature practical, hands-on exercises and examples. (It
is presented for the non- mathematically inclined.)
